This beach aparthotel enjoys a peaceful location on the coast of Nuevo Horizonte just 2 kms from Calete de Fuste on the idyllic island of Fuerteventura. The complex is a short distance away from the beautiful local sandy beach and a leisurely stroll will take guests to the nearest public transport network which offers ease of access to other areas. The tasteful apartments offer a modern home away from home and come equipped with up-to-date amenities for guests' convenience. The complex affords guests an array of leisure and recreational facilities. Those looking for a relaxing break can sit back and unwind amidst the sun-drenched surroundings while thrill-seekers can enjoy a selection of activities, including windsurfing, diving and boat trips.

Travelled on 26 July 2026
The only reason i am giving this hotel a 3 star is purely for the staff! I'd just like to make the point that we didn't go expecting 5*, and go to 'budget' hotels not expecting the ritz, but expecting some key things that we just didn't get here. Rooms: As we expected from previous reviews, the rooms are dated and abit bashed but tidy... I say tidy because both of our 2 ground floor rooms had tiny little ants everywhere. These bugs have since followed us home in our luggage, meaning all clothes we washed over there to try and limit the washing needing done on return home are now having to be boil washed. Rooms were swept, bins emptied, beds made & bathroom sprayed and cleaned daily. Mopped couple of times during the 10 days we were there, and towels changed on a Monday, Wednesday & Friday. Both bathrooms had faults, one was a sunken tiled shower with a curtain and the hot and cold piped backward. This room flooded everytime you showered meaning you had to sacrifice one of your towels as a bath mat to avoid the bathroom turning into a pool. The other had a bath with an overhead shower, the bath has been installed backwards causing us to nearly slip on the bath slope several times when showering. Food: We are a family of fussy eaters so I don't feel we could review this fairly, all i could say is yes, the selection is smaller than other hotels we have previously been to. BUT, there was always a selection of meat, veg, salad and basic items such as pasta, pizza, chips & soup at lunch and tea times. For breakfast there was the usual full English items and either churos or pancakes, the only thing we would've liked more of at breakfast would be more of a fresh fruit selection, (melon, peaches, mandarins ecs.). Every night is a different theme (on rotation) so there is a different food selection most nights, the Asian nights were our favourite! At all meals the food was a palatable temperature (not boiling hot but not cold) and the puddings mostly consisted of various types of jelly, 1 type of cake & profiteroles, with odd days having marshmallows. The staff where amazing! always clearing away used plates & glasses and were very friendly. Drinks: Hot & soft drinks are self serve at the pool bar from 10am - 6pm, alcohol, water & kids cock tail (the Sanfrancisco- red grenedine with fresh mixed fruit juice) are ordered at the bar. Never had to wait more that 5 mins and staff were very friendly. At meals fresh juice was self serve but soft (fizzy) & alcohol had to be ordered at the bar, queues varied based on what time you went to eat. Pool: THE POOL IS FREEZING! i can't stress this enough, the pool is the coldest pool we have ever been to. We have vacationed in the cannerys a good few times now and are aware that the pools are on the cooler side due to the wind, BUT, this pool is on another level of cold, take your breath away kind of cold! It was so cold that our 3 year old couldn't tolerate it, and subsequently developed a fear of going in, leading to him spending the bulk of his holiday with limited entertainment through the day. Our older children were able to tolerate it in stints but were very cold and shaky after being in, especially our 5 year old who had to be immediately wrapped up and placed in the sun to warm up. I would say that if you are travelling with children under 4 then the pools may be to cold for them to FULLY enjoy their holiday. The render on the pool itself is completely blown on the top portion of the pool, and you can feel the whole floor move when you walk on it, parts throught out the pool have also come away compleatly exposing sharp sides and the concrete below. It is however cleaned every night and the area around the pool is generally tidy. Sunbeds are locked up every night an not unlocked until what is ment to be 10am but generally ranges between 09:15 - 09:45, there is no desperate scramble for beds nor is there dramatic running to get towels out, but if you arrive later for a space around the pool (past 10ish) you are going to be disappointed, as there is, as is the case with 99% of hotels, a limited amount of beds available. Entertainment: The Entertainment is very scarce but what there is, is good. The male entertainer is brilliant through the day, on the days he does the aqua dancing and pool entertainment. The blue pool mat was brought out for around 20 mins on several of the days and the kids loved it! An inflatable assault course and bouncy castle come on 1 of the 10 days, these were amazing, its just a shame they don't do these more often. Evening entertainment leaves alot to be desired, and is limited to what I can only describe as the worst set up entertainment room we've ever seen! Its more like a night club bar and absolutely not suitable to be the core evening entertainment room at all. The hotel does have a big function hall with a stage that could be used for shown ecs., where visitors could sit at a table and enjoy their evening, the hotel is not utilising this at all. We don't like to compare hotels to other hotels, but, the Elba Lucia seriously needs to sit down and figure out where they're going wrong with their evening entertainment line up and fix it asap! We've never known a hotel have such a limited evening entertainment that is entirey made up of their 2 entertainers doing the best they can with visibly limited resources and a singer that comes in a couple of nights a week, especially when they're a family hotel. Location: Very close to the airport (less than 10 min transfer) and arround €15 in a taxi if you want to save on the coach transfer fee. The hotel has a great vue for seeing planes coming in to land with small children who find that interesting, not much around in terms of shops but there is a cluster of restaurants a 3-5 min walk away. Free shuttle to the shopping center at 10:20, 11:20 & 12:20 but the last return from the center back to the hotel on the free shuttle is 12:10. A taxi is only €4.90 back though. A taxi into Caleta is €3.50 so i wouldn't say the location is a deal breaker. Room extension: Out flight home wasnt until 20:30, with the transfer not coming until 17:45. As we have 4 children and nowhere to go we requested to extend our room until 3pm. We were told that they do not offer this service during July & August, but we could store out cases in their secure room and still use all the facilities and towels as normal, showering in the hotel gym showers. We took this on the chin as, if they don't offer it, they don't offer it. We later got talking to another guest around the pool and she had actually been allowed to extend her room until 3pm for reasons i'm not going to get into, but weren't dissimilar to our own experience, this understandably infuriated us as it felt one rule for one and one for another! Our sunbeds were directly outside our room and we could see that our room wasn't actually cleaned after us leaving at 12pm until after 14:30 and didn't have new guests in it by the time we were leaving at 17:45, so not being able to extend our check out time was not down to availability. The nice little video they play on the hotel television, showing the other hotels the franchise owns shows that the Elba Lucia seems to be the forgotten work horse of the Elba chain! Judging by how much we paid for our stay, and timesing that by how many other family's where there, it doesn't seem that the revenue the hotel is bringing is actually going back into the hotel its self. Hopefully this will change one day as with some renovation, or just some general attention from the franchise, and a complete overhaul of their entertainment package it could be a really nice hotel.

A Respectful 3 Star Hotel
Travelled on 20 July 2026
It does what it says on the tin. A 3star hotel you should not expect the world. Ultimately a holiday is only as fun as you make it. It is most definitely classed as a 3 star correctly, however we have been low 4 stars which are similar in terms so with a few tweaks it could push for a 4*. For starters, Check in is 15:00 but you can check in before, use the amenities and All inclusive from when you arrive. Our room was ready earlier than that and they will call you when your room is ready. Reception staff are friendly and easy check in. The location of the hotel is very close to the airport. Just under 15 euro taxi. You can't hear or see the planes from the pool or hotel with a few rooms on the far side where you can hear and see them but once the door is shut it is silent so that does not make any impact. It is around a 45 minute walk to the local town (Castillo Caleta de Fuste) Which is a really nice town and definitely worth a visit to especially for the beach. It is a 5 euro taxi so definitely accessible and worth a visit. The actual area at the hotel is so quiet and not much around it. But if you do your research than you understand that and already accept it. A quiet retreat is what this is. The rooms are on the dated side however fully adequate and it is what you expect for a 3 star. No A/C i thought would be the end of the world. Fans are available to be rented but with the balcony doors open it cooled down the room nicely. So it didn't worry too much and was bearable. We were located in the sports section of the hotel, on the second floor S204. Lifts are available for the rooms (Out of action for the restaurant and bar at the moment). I had actually requested a room in this part as i saw reviews that it is quieter side and that a breeze which went into the room. Our view backed onto some palm trees with the airport in the distance seeing the runway and planes land aswell as a sea view, all be it not the best but we could still see it through the trees. The room had a kitchen area with a working fridge and all the things needed for self catering. Bathroom with hand soap and shower gel included which was handy. Towels are changed every Wednesday, Friday, and Sunday. Not a fan i would rather changed everyday but will not complain as we made do. Bed sheets are changed once a week. Rooms are cleaned daily. Room with an actual key so don't loose it! Lots of sports can be played at a cost, tennis, badminton, etc. The pool area is a really good standard and very fun. No reserving sunbeds is perfect. Sunbeds are stacked up every morning so grab one and find a place to put one and enjoy. With a choice of shade or sun take your pick. The pool is a good temperature once you are in. Their are steps and levels to the pool so suitable for all if you want deep or be able to stand in. Aswell as ledges to sit in the pool and relax. Pool balls, floats and dive sticks are all allowed which is good fun. A really enjoyable pool area. IKER is amazing as many people have said before. Interacting with both children and adults with a small choice but activities for all. The pool bar has a really good selection of drinks for all inclusive, including non alcoholic heinkien which i haven't seen in a while. Good selection of cocktails aswell as self service soft drinks. Ice creams avaliable aswell as snacks from 15:00. The bar upstairs is small, does the job and live music is often. It does the job! You can take drinks back to room in paper cups which is good. Food. Small selection, but enough to fill a plate or 2! It is a 3 star remember. Food did vary each day with not much being repeated, which was nice to have variation. The dinning room was small and dark, old not a fan. We sat outdoors alot which was nice to sit outside but not the nicest area but oh well. Tables were cleaned as quick as possible with a small group of staff. You can help yourself to water and juices, coffee at breakfast. With soft drinks having to wait behind a podium to be served by a member of staff. Weird but okay. Breakfast, your usual hot meas, scrambled egg only no omlettes. Sausages which were british and nice. Bacon, beans, hash browns one day, pancakes the other day and churros the day after. A small continental selection which wasn't the best. 2 yogurts and some fruit. Breads and toaster etc. Lunch at the restaurant had changed daily and was alright. Dinner theme changed each night and despite a small selection their was always lot to eat and it was nice enough. Desserts were awful and same each day pretty much. Improvement needed there. I really enjoyed asian night. The staff are brilliant, especially iker. Top top. We went into this with very low expectations and was pleasantly surprised. We definitely had a good and enjoyable time!
